FCMR: Robust Evaluation of Financial Cross-Modal Multi-Hop Reasoning

现实决策常需整合多模态信息进行推理。尽管近年多模态大语言模型(MLLMs)在该任务上展现出潜力,其跨多种数据源的多跳推理能力仍缺乏充分评估。现有基准如MMQA存在数据污染和复杂查询不足的问题,难以准确衡量性能。为此,我们提出金融跨模态多跳推理(FCMR)基准,旨在通过文本报告、表格和图表等多模态数据,评估MLLMs的推理能力。FCMR分为易、中、难三个层级,其中难题要求精确的跨模态三跳推理,防止忽略任一模态。实验表明,即使最先进模型(Claude 3.5 Sonnet)在最难点也仅达30.4%准确率。我们进一步分析模型内部机制,发现信息检索阶段存在关键瓶颈。

原文摘要 · Abstract (English)

Real-world decision-making often requires integrating and reasoning over information from multiple modalities. While recent multimodal large language models (MLLMs) have shown promise in such tasks, their ability to perform multi-hop reasoning across diverse sources remains insufficiently evaluated. Existing benchmarks, such as MMQA, face challenges due to (1) data contamination and (2) a lack of complex queries that necessitate operations across more than two modalities, hindering accurate performance assessment. To address this, we present Financial Cross-Modal Multi-Hop Reasoning (FCMR), a benchmark created to analyze the reasoning capabilities of MLLMs by urging them to combine information from textual reports, tables, and charts within the financial domain. FCMR is categorized into three difficulty levels-Easy, Medium, and Hard-facilitating a step-by-step evaluation. In particular, problems at the Hard level require precise cross-modal three-hop reasoning and are designed to prevent the disregard of any modality. Experiments on this new benchmark reveal that even state-of-the-art MLLMs struggle, with the best-performing model (Claude 3.5 Sonnet) achieving only 30.4% accuracy on the most challenging tier. We also conduct analysis to provide insights into the inner workings of the models, including the discovery of a critical bottleneck in the information retrieval phase.
